Word Addition: Compound Words 1
This worksheet requires some addition, but it doesn't involve numbers. To make compound words, kids add two words together to make a new one, as in news + paper = newspaper. For each item on the worksheet, kids see a word that's the first part of the compound word. Using the picture as a clue, they find the second part of the word in the word box. Finally, they put the two parts together to write the compound word. Reading compound words is an important part of decoding and word recognition, knowledge your child can apply to achieve fluent oral and silent reading.
